Administration / County Administrator
The County Administrator is the Chief Administrative Officer for the County and is governed by Wisconsin State Statute 59.18.
The position was created in 2015 by the County Board to bring professional management to Price County government. County Administrator duties include:

-
Coordinate and direct the administrative management functions of county government not otherwise vested by law in boards, commissions, or other elected officials including the hiring of and supervision of all non-elected county department heads.
- Appoint members of boards, committees, and commissions subject to the approval of the County Board.
-
Formulate and recommend policy to the County Board through the annual budget or through formal interaction with the County Board and/or Board Committees.
-
Act as good-will ambassador on behalf of the County. Regularly communicates with the business community and public officials outside of county government.
